With a 300kN rating, these insulators are engineered for heavy-ice regions and large-span crossings where tensile strength is non-negotiable.
Our toughened glass undergoes a precise tempering process, creating high-level compressive stress on the surface to resist extreme temperature fluctuations.
Unlike porcelain, toughened glass provides a "zero-value" self-shattering feature, allowing ground maintenance teams to visually identify faulty units instantly.
The manufacturing of the U300bl series involves a sophisticated "Total Oxygen Kiln" process, ensuring the homogeneity of the glass melt. Our Anti-Pollution Type insulators feature deep under-ribs, increasing the creepage distance significantly. This design prevents salt-fog bridging and reduces maintenance cycles by 40%.
The Aerodynamic (Open Profile) design prevents the accumulation of sand and solid pollutants on the lower surface, utilizing natural wind flow for self-cleaning.
High-altitude environments demand superior corona performance. Our U300bl designs are tested for radio interference and visual corona extinction levels far exceeding standard IEC requirements.
